Recent Trends in Global Disease Reporting

Historically, media attention to disease outbreaks fluctuates based on outbreak severity and geographic spread. The current surge, as indicated by GDELT data, follows several recent regional outbreaks, including influenza spikes in Asia and COVID-19 variants in Europe. Past increases in coverage have often preceded or coincided with heightened public health alerts and policy measures, though the direct correlation remains complex.

Previously, media reports have played a role in shaping public responses to outbreaks, sometimes leading to increased demand for health measures or vaccination campaigns. The recent data suggests a similar pattern may be emerging, but the full scope of coverage impact remains to be seen.

Key Questions

Does increased media coverage mean there are more disease outbreaks?

Not necessarily. The surge in reports may reflect increased media interest rather than a direct increase in disease cases. Further epidemiological data is needed to confirm actual outbreak trends.

Which diseases are most frequently mentioned in recent coverage?

Reports have primarily focused on influenza, COVID-19 variants, and other infectious diseases, though specific mentions vary by region and outbreak severity.

Could this media surge influence public health policies?

Yes, increased media attention can prompt governments and health organizations to implement or adjust health measures, but the actual policy response depends on confirmed epidemiological data.

Is this increase in coverage unusual?

Media attention to disease outbreaks fluctuates over time; a spike like this is notable but not unprecedented. It often follows or coincides with regional outbreaks or new variants.
